A Streetcar Named Desire stands as a classic example of character-driven storytelling where the dialogue feels authentic and serves to deepen the audience's understanding of the characters' psyches. The film's exploration of desire, mental illness, and interpersonal conflict is compelling without resorting to heavy-handed messaging.
The characters, particularly Blanche, are richly developed and embody the complexities of human emotion rather than functioning as mere symbols for social commentary. While there are themes that challenge traditional values, they are presented with nuance, allowing for a more profound engagement with the narrative.
